It’s April which means the NFL Draft is inching closer and closer. The first-round of the draft begins on Thursday April 25, but for now the Dallas Cowboys do not have a pick to make on that day. Without a trade up, they will first select on Friday during the second round.

Fortunately mock drafts are starting to stretch out, giving an indication of who some feel will be available. ESPN’s Mel Kiper and Todd McShay created their annual two-round mock this week.
